I'm one of those people who believes in "the less clutter, the better," so I'm always loathe to purchase kitchen equipment that I might never use. I fear complicated and difficult-to-clean devices in particular. In my house, things that aren't dishwasher safe go to Goodwill in a hurry.
No part of the Zojirushi cooker is dishwasher safe, but that didn't stop me from falling in love with it after the first batch of perfectly-cooked rice. Unlike the pots I used to use to cook rice, this little machine's solid non-stick coated bowl sloughs off any and all bits of rice with the lightest brush of my hand. It's a cinch to clean. Handwashing the rice cooker bowl takes thirty seconds. That's less time than it used to take me to prewash/scrub the pots I used to use to cook rice before putting them in the dishwasher.
What's more, the rice comes out perfectly and evenly cooked; the machine plays cute songs when starting and stopping the cooking process, making cooking seem a little less awful (I hate cooking); the timer function means I don't lose any sleep getting fresh rice ready at 5 AM when I pack my husband's lunch; and the mixed rice function lets me throw in bits of chicken or other items to be cooked at the same time.
I couldn't be happier with this rice cooker and would recommend it to anyone who is considering a small cooker for their own family.
